Hello,
just to clarify what is meant here: installing the package x2goplugin on my ubuntu machine will install the x2goplugin into the Mozilla browser installed on my machine. But is there any way currently to serve the x2goplugin via a web server, to remotely make it available to any virgin mozilla browser trying to connect to the x2go server?
According to the deprecated documentation, this was being done with an xpi package for mozilla, but the one that can be found online is no longer compatible with the latest versions of Firefox.
